E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
微服务架构设计思想
javajdbc连接池,原理+实战讲解
2014年,由MartinFowler与JamesLewis共同提出了微服务的概念,定义了
微服务架构
风格是一种通过一套小型服务来开发单个应用的方法,每个服务运行在自己的进程中,并通过轻量级的机制进行通讯
哆啦A梦没有口袋.
·
2023-10-29 08:23
程序员
java
经验分享
面试
8.Gateway服务网关
SpringCloudGateway是SpringCloud的一个全新项目,该项目是基于Spring5.0,SpringBoot2.0和ProjectReactor等响应式编程和事件流技术开发的网关,它旨在为
微服务架构
提供一种简单有效的统一的
动感zz
·
2023-10-29 08:11
微服务学习
spring
cloud
java
gateway
微服务
SpringCloud 微服务全栈体系(六)
SpringCloudGateway是SpringCloud的一个全新项目,该项目是基于Spring5.0,SpringBoot2.0和ProjectReactor等响应式编程和事件流技术开发的网关,它旨在为
微服务架构
提供一种简单有效的统一的
柠檬小帽
·
2023-10-29 07:21
微服务全栈体系
spring
cloud
微服务
spring
Netty核心源码剖析
Netty线程模型Netty高并发高性能架构设计精髓主从Reactor线程模型NIO多路复用非阻塞无锁串行化
设计思想
支持高性能序列化协议零拷贝(直接内存的使用)ByteBuf内存池设计灵活的TCP参数配置能力并发优化无锁串行化
设计思想
在大多数场景下
Firechou
·
2023-10-29 07:39
#
Netty
netty
源码
docker ,k8s 以及 k8s 和 docker的关系
Docker和Kubernetes(简称k8s)是两种广泛使用的开源平台,它们都在容器化和
微服务架构
中扮演了关键角色。下面我会先分别介绍这两个工具,然后解释它们之间的关系。
爱吃土豆的马铃薯ㅤㅤㅤㅤㅤㅤㅤㅤㅤ
·
2023-10-29 07:27
docker
kubernetes
容器
vue+springboot+springcloud项目实战(1)- 项目简介及环境搭建
光子商城出自尚硅谷雷丰阳老师的电商项目谷粒商城基于SpringBoot2.x、SpringCould2.x、redis、docker、vue…分布式、微服务、前后端分离一、项目介绍一个B2C模式的电商平台,向用户销售自营的商品二、项目
微服务架构
图三
小李同学呦
·
2023-10-29 05:45
光子商城项目实战
docker
微服务
spring
boot
spring
cloud
vue
图解Kafka高性能之谜(五)
详细架构设计:高性能的磁盘写技术高性能的消息查找设计索引文件定位使用跳表的设计偏移量定位消息时使用稀疏索引:高响应的磁盘拷贝技术批处理设计请求亲和性设计内存池高效、安全设计高性能、安全的数据结构分段锁的
设计思想
多线程协同设计粘性分区算法
张家老院子
·
2023-10-28 23:29
源码解读
伸缩式架构设计
kafka
分布式
浅谈分布式系统
文章目录分布式系统应用数据分离架构应用服务集群架构读写分离/主从分离架构引入缓存--冷热分离架构数据库分库分表存储集群
微服务架构
小结分布式系统只有一台服务器负责所有的工作称为单机架构,但是一台主机的硬件资源是有上限的
CHJBL
·
2023-10-28 23:24
Redis
redis
分布式
Spring-手写模拟Spring底层原理
aware回调、初始化前、初始化、初始化后、切面未实现的功能:构造器推断、循环依赖重点:BeanDefinition、BeanPostProcessor学习Spring源码的重点:设计模式、编码规范、
设计思想
有梦想的年轻人6174
·
2023-10-28 20:14
spring
java
php laravel restful api,larvel php restful_Laravel-RestfulAPI 资源控制器(全面详解)
前言:RESTful是一种
设计思想
、一种普遍接受的规范。我们的资源控制器,和RESTful有着莫大的联系,要理解资源控制器,必须先了解RESTful。
拽气崽崽
·
2023-10-28 19:36
php
laravel
restful
api
前后端分离不可忽视的陷阱,深入剖析挑战,分享解决方案,助你顺利实施分离开发。
前后端分离的利与弊近几年,随着
微服务架构
风格的引入、前后端生态的快速发展、多端产品化的出现,前后端分离已经成为行业的普遍实践,也是大型企业级分布式架构的缺省选择。
技术琐事
·
2023-10-28 17:31
前端框架
后端
java
js
html5
Flex开发流程设计器的经验之谈
既然名称中有“GEF”,那么肯定会与EclipseGEF的设计会有所类似,事实上,本身就是借鉴GEF的
设计思想
和对象概念模型,只是做了改造和简化。如下图所示。
似来
·
2023-10-28 17:46
flex
flash
eclipse
图形
command
mvc
微服务-开篇
微服务一、微服务的概念二、微服务的现状三、微服务的优劣势四、分布式和微服务的关系1、概念方面2、结合生产问题进行理解3、小结五、常见的
微服务架构
之间的对比一、微服务的概念维基上对其定义为:一种软件开发技术
chad__chang
·
2023-10-28 14:19
Java
微服务
java
spring
cloud
【微服务开篇-RestTemplate服务调用、Eureka注册中心、Nacos注册中心】
1.认识微服务随着互联网行业的发展,对服务的要求也越来越高,服务架构也从单体架构逐渐演变为现在流行的
微服务架构
。1.1.单体架构单体架构:将业务的所有功能集中在一个项目中开发,打成一个包部署。
Allengan@wow
·
2023-10-28 14:48
微服务
微服务
eureka
架构
java
spring
cloud
JavaGUI实现科学计算器
JavaGUI实现科学计算器一、
设计思想
界面及布局利用Java中awt、swing包里的工具对计算器布局设计(为了使运算可控,所以将文本区只能设为从Button输入)给每个Button加监听器对于数字和运算符
逝眼云烟
·
2023-10-28 13:13
Java
GUI
计算器
Node.js 的适用场景
目录编辑前言适用场景1.实时应用用法代码理解2.API服务器用法代码示例理解3.
微服务架构
用法代码示例理解总结前言Node.js是一个基于ChromeV8引擎的JavaScript运行环境,它使得JavaScript
锅盖哒
·
2023-10-28 12:44
node.js
DDD(领域驱动模型) 和 MVC 模型的对比
DDD(领域驱动设计)和MVC(模型-视图-控制器)是两种不同的软件开发模式和
设计思想
,它们在软件架构和设计中有着不同的关注点和目标。
計贰
·
2023-10-28 09:49
java
系统架构
java
外卖跑腿小程序开发如何满足不断变化的用户需求?
采用
微服务架构
,这允许您将不同的功能划分为独立的服务,从而可以更快地响应需求变化。以下是使用Node.js和Express.js的示例代码来创建一个简单的订
万岳科技
·
2023-10-28 08:06
数据库
源码
php
React飞行日记(二) -邂逅React
-React渐进式框架:最流行的框架
设计思想
我们在使用一个框架的时候,如果只想使用其中几个功能,但是需要引入一个庞大的框架,过于臃肿,这时候渐进式框架的特点就来了特点:能够把各个功能进行拆分,让用户自己组合功能
狄鸠
·
2023-10-28 06:54
7.React飞行日记
Java并发编程解析 | 基于JDK源码解析Java领域中并发锁之StampedLock锁的
设计思想
与实现原理 (三)
苍穹之边,浩瀚之挚,眰恦之美;悟心悟性,善始善终,惟善惟道!——朝槿《朝槿兮年说》写在开头在并发编程领域,有两大核心问题:一个是互斥,即同一时刻只允许一个线程访问共享资源;另一个是同步,即线程之间如何通信、协作。主要原因是,对于多线程实现实现并发,一直以来,多线程都存在2个问题:线程之间内存共享,需要通过加锁进行控制,但是加锁会导致性能下降,同时复杂的加锁机制也会增加编程编码难度过多线程造成线程之
朝槿木兮
·
2023-10-28 05:38
Spring Boot 搭建笔记
背景快速适应项目现有后台框架亲身体验项目痛点并注入改进
设计思想
重拾Java相关知识点一、SpringBoot项目搭建工程目录结构1.入口文件packagecom.zb.zbook;importorg.mybatis.spring.annotation.MapperScan
jyjin
·
2023-10-28 04:50
Java
java
spring
spring
boot
mybatis
Spring Cloud Alibaba 整合gateway
网关是什么网关是所有服务请求的一个统一入口,方便我们对服务请求与响应做统一的管理网关的核心功能是路由转发,同时还可以做限流、熔断、日志监控、认证为什么我们需要网关我们在
微服务架构
的时候,把我们的业务员拆分为一个个小的服务
Gideon丶M
·
2023-10-28 02:18
spring
cloud
alibaba
spring
gateway
Spring Cloud之API网关(Gateway)
路由配置方式1.yml配置文件路由2.bean进行配置3.动态路由动态路由Predicate(断言)特点常见断言示例Filter(过滤器)filter分类Pre类型Post类型网关过滤器格式示例全局过滤器示例在
微服务架构
中
lgcgkCQ
·
2023-10-28 01:57
Spring
Cloud
java
spring
SpringCloud
网关
Gateway
031-从零搭建微服务-监控中心(一)
源码地址(后端):mingyue:基于SpringBoot、SpringCloud&Alibaba的分布式
微服务架构
基础服务中心源码地址(前端):mingyue-ui:基于Vue3+TS+Vite+Elementplus
Strive_MY
·
2023-10-27 22:52
MingYue微服务
微服务
架构
云原生
如何进行微服务测试?一文4个知识点带入门微服务测试!
微服务架构
是一种越来越流行的构建复杂分布式系统的方法。在此体系结构中,大型应用程序被分成较小的、独立的服务,这些服务通过网络相互通信。微服务测试是确保这些服务无缝协同工作的关键步骤。
自动化测试 老司机
·
2023-10-27 21:38
软件测试
自动化测试
测试工程师
微服务
架构
单元测试
软件测试
自动化测试
性能测试
测试工具
对spring cloud的个人理解
Springcloud是一个基于SpringBoot实现的服务治理工具包,用于
微服务架构
中管理和协调各个服务的。springcloud是一系列框架的有序集合。
时仙
·
2023-10-27 20:22
大体理解
java
spring
spring
boot
微服务实战 07Spring Cloud Gateway 入门与实战
SpringCloudGatewayAPI网关
微服务架构
中存在的问题API网关SpringCloudGatewaySpringCloudGateway中的几个概念Gataway工作流程Gataway实战
1999
·
2023-10-27 20:29
springCloud
Alibaba
微服务
spring
cloud
java
spring cloud gateway 入门
springcloudgateway概述SpringCloudGateway是Spring官方基于Spring5.0,SpringBoot2.0和ProjectReactor等技术开发的网关,SpringCloudGateway旨在为
微服务架构
提供一种简单而有效的统一的
m0_67402125
·
2023-10-27 20:54
java
java
后端
golang工程组件之网关grpc-gateway
一、概述在现代的
微服务架构
中,网关是一个非常重要的组件。它负责接收和处理客户端请求,并将它们转发给相应的服务。
SMILY12138
·
2023-10-27 19:41
golang
gateway
开发语言
Framework -- 系统架构
App的启动流程:整体的过程,具体到某些类在整个流程中所起的作用;组件的设计模式,核心
设计思想
;需要知晓目前已知的问题,以及解决方案。
郑子
·
2023-10-27 17:12
Android:系统架构篇
系统架构
软件测试面试真题 | 什么是PO设计模式?
考察点《pageobject设计模式》:PageObject设计模式的
设计思想
、设计原则《web自动化测试实战》:结合PageObject在真实项目中的实践与应用情况传统UI自动化的问题无法适应UI频繁变化无法清晰表达业务用例场景大量的样板代码
测试涛叔
·
2023-10-27 17:16
技术分享
自动化测试
软件测试
面试
设计模式
职场和发展
数据结构算法每日一练(七)数组未出现最小正整数
要求:1)给出算法的基本
设计思想
。2)根据
设计思想
,来用C或C++语言描述算法,关键之处给出注释。3)说明你所设计算法的时问复杂度和空
北以晨光丶
·
2023-10-27 17:14
数据结构算法每日一练
数据结构
算法
c语言
数组
c++
【标记数组】数据结构练习 2018统考真题
要求:1)给出算法的基本
设计思想
。2)根据
设计思想
,采用C或C++语言描述算法,关键之处给出注释。3)说明你所设计的算法的时间复杂度和空间复杂度。设计思路:仅要求时间复杂度,那么优先选用空间
Savage277
·
2023-10-27 17:10
数据结构练习
数据结构
算法
c++
基于
微服务架构
的智慧工地云平台系统源码
SpringCloud智慧工地源码,智慧建造源码系统概述:智慧工地云平台系统,依托计算机技术、物联网、云计算、大数据、人工智能、VR&AR等技术相结合,对建筑工地中的管理人员、施工人员、车辆/物料、施工设备、视频监控等数据有效采集,实时监控、控制项目的进度和成本。为工程项目管理提供先进技术手段,构建工地现场智能监控和控制体系,弥补传统方法在监管中的缺陷,最终实现项目对人、机、料、法、环的全方位实时
淘源码d
·
2023-10-27 16:10
智慧工地云平台源码(高端源码)
架构
微服务
云原生
【Java】基于
微服务架构
的智慧工地监管云平台源码带APP
前言:智慧工地监管平台是一种利用物联网、云计算、大数据等技术手段实现工地信息化管理的解决方案。它通过数据采集、分析和应用,在实时监控、风险预警、资源调度等方面为工地管理者提供了全方位的支持,提高了工地管理的效率和质量。智慧监管平台还基于“云+端”架构设计,通过对前端设备采集数据进行分析研判,构建线上、线下相结合,指挥、管理、预警、分析、监测五位一体的监管体系,提供身份识别、数据分析、预警指挥、监控
星辰大海里编程
·
2023-10-27 16:37
智慧工地源码
架构
java
微服务
spring
cloud
SpringCloud学习:一【详细】
目录服务架构演变单体架构分布式架构分布式架构需要考虑的问题
微服务架构
比较微服务技术对比服务拆分注意事项案例服务远程调用RestTemplateEureka注册中心RestTemplate存在的问题服务调用考虑的问题
zmbwcx
·
2023-10-27 16:39
spring
cloud
学习
spring
Spring常见问题总结
此文章来源于SnailClimb@https://mp.weixin.qq.com/s/yaY3gcP0aEp7w-mUwl1yCQIOCIoC(InverseofControl:控制反转)是一种
设计思想
紫厢雨
·
2023-10-27 15:43
python DevOps
在这样的环境中,Python的特点和优势如下:
微服务架构
:云原生应用通常基于
微服务架构
,这意味着应用被拆分为一系列小的、独立的服务,每个服务执行应用的特定功能。Python由于其简洁性、
The Straggling Crow
·
2023-10-27 15:54
devops
python
开发语言
SpringCloud
一、微服务1.1、
微服务架构
4个核心问题服务很多,客户端怎么访问?这么多服务,服务之间如何通信?这么多服务,如何治理?服务挂了怎么办?
一只野良猫w
·
2023-10-27 14:28
狂神说Java学习
java
springcloud
一文带你马上了解 Service Mesh在百度网盘数万后端的实践落地
点击右侧链接即可打开个人博客):大牛带你入门技术栈1背景起初,在网盘快速发展期,为了快速上线,采用了服务单体化+主干开发模式进行研发,随着用户规模爆发式的增长以及产品形态的丰富,单体化的不足就体现出来了,于是架构上采用了
微服务架构
AI科学小老师
·
2023-10-27 13:20
浅谈Linux可视化监控平台 - WGCLOUD
以及业务系统的进程、端口、日志信息、服务接口,对比下来,选择了WGCLOUD,可以完全满足我们的需求,最重要的是它部署简单,使用方便,轻量实用,对新手极其友好它可以内网部署运行,不需要联网WGCLOUD
设计思想
为新一代极简运维监控系统
玉下江南
·
2023-10-27 13:09
运维监控工具
linux
运维
服务器
2023最新版Java高手学习路线图课程
Java学习路线图分为7个阶段,包含:Java基础–>数据库核心技术–>JavaWeb核心技术–>企业必备技术–>SSM框架–>大厂提升技能–>
微服务架构
–>大型项目与解决方案–>大厂必备面试,具体内容如下
Mr·Arvin
·
2023-10-27 12:40
java
学习
开发语言
axios 源码精读
前言阅读框架源码的好处在于提升编程水平,以及了解框架的
设计思想
,配合其官方文档,让我们对它的使用变得更加得心应手。
程序员柳随风
·
2023-10-27 10:09
源码阅读
服务注册和发现是什么意思?Spring Cloud 如何实现?
在
微服务架构
中,每个服务都是独立运行的,需要通过服务注册中心来管理和调用。服务注册中心是一个集中的服务实例的注册和发现的地方。当一个服务实例启动时,它会向服务注册中
customer08
·
2023-10-27 10:05
java
spring
cloud
spring
后端
【软考系统架构设计师】2016年下系统架构师论文写作历年真题
】2016年下系统架构师论文写作历年真题2016年下系统架构师试题一(系统架构评估)2016年下系统架构师试题二(设计模式)2016年下系统架构师试题三(数据访问层设计)2016年下系统架构师试题四(
微服务架构
进击的横打
·
2023-10-27 10:12
浅谈java设计模式之模板模式
通过不断地深入的学习JAVA开发语言,才意识到熟悉掌握JAVA开发
设计思想
尤其重要。今天就先浅谈一下模板模式。
邦邦邦呀
·
2023-10-27 07:07
CompletableFuture 实战
以一个商品查询为例,在
微服务架构
中,一个商品信息查询会涉及商品基本信息查询、商品评论查询、商品库存查询,每个查询都涉及不同的微服务的调用,如果使用异步编程的方式,应该如何实现呢?
明雨星云
·
2023-10-27 07:46
JAVA
java
vue和react有什么不同?(面试问答)
简短回答:据我了解vue和react的不同主要分为以下⼏个⽅⾯,⾸先是react是基于数据不可变的,在react中数据流是单向的,⽽vue中的
设计思想
是响应式的,是基于数据可变的。
script~
·
2023-10-27 06:52
vue.js
react.js
javascript
前端面试题1-vue和react的区别
vue和react的区别他们的功能相似(组件化开发),但是
设计思想
是不同的,以下列举了四点不同数据双向绑定react函数式思想,数据不可变,单向数据流(结合redux-form可以实现双向)vue响应式思想
杰瑞同学
·
2023-10-27 06:22
前端面试题
vue.js
前端
react.js
层次式架构的设计理论与实践
层次式架构的设计理论与实践层次式架构概述层次式架构的定义和特性定义特性层次式架构的一般组成(表现层、中间层、数据访问层和数据层)表现层框架设计设计模式MVCMVPMVVMXML技术UIP
设计思想
表现层动态生成
设计思想
骚戴
·
2023-10-27 05:23
#
系统架构师【案例分析】
层次式架构的设计理论与实践
系统架构师
软考
上一页
42
43
44
45
46
47
48
49
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他